Overview
The C-Vision HD system by C-Tecnics is a comprehensive high-definition camera and recording package designed for real-time viewing and recording of HD images. It includes features such as live on-screen data display, high-intensity LED lamps, and laser pointer modules, all powered through a single umbilical cable.
Physical Specifications
  • Dimensions: 490 x 390 x 230mm
  • Weight: 14kg
  • IP Rating: IP65
  • Case: Hardigg Storm case
  • Power Supply: 110-230V, 50/60Hz, 600W max
  • Operating Temperature: -20°C to +60°C
  • Storage Temperature: 0°C to +50°C
  • Keyboard & Mouse: Inbuilt, IP68 84 Key keyboard with integrated pointer
Processor and Storage
  • Processor: Embedded Motherboard with Intel Atom N270, 1.6GHz
  • Storage: Single 640Gb SATA drive, partitioned as 40Gb System and 600Gb Recording drive
  • Operating System: Microsoft Windows XP Embedded
HD Video Capabilities
  • Input: HD Component (Y, Pr, Pb)
  • Camera: Mantis HD Camera (CT3009) with 1/3-inch CMOS sensor, 10x optical zoom, and 1080i HD output
Display Features
  • Size: 15.4” WXGA LCD Panel
  • Resolution: 1280 x 768 Pixels
  • Contrast: 700:1
  • Luminance: 470cd/m2
  • Viewing Angles: 85° horizontal and vertical
Additional Features
  • Portable and robust design in a briefcase style carry case
  • Control over two "Tetra" laser pointer modules and two CT-4003 LED lights
  • Zoom and focus controls for the HD Camera
  • Multiple ports for live video stream and data transfer

C-VISION HD-1

Portable, Waterproof, Robust and now in High Definition! The C-Vision HD, High Definition Camera and Recording System from C-Tecnics is a complete package of equipment that allows for the real-time viewing and recording of full high definition camera images onto magnetic hard disk drive, with the addition of a live on-screen display of serial data fields such as GPS data, or ship’s survey NMEA data-stream. The system also incorporates two high intensity LED lamps and two laser pointer modules. All power and functionality to the camera, lights and lasers is provided through a single umbilical which is split out subsea using a subsea pressure pod. C-VISION HD-2

C-Vision HD Surface Control Unit The SCU equips the operator with a compact single control station, providing control over all functionality of the system. The complete SCU is incorporated into a single medium sized briefcase style carry case which weighs only 14kg! The system has excellent protection against the elements and is packaged for optimum portability and robustness. It also boasts a 15.4” screen which C-Tecnics have specifically chosen for its notable brightness and viewing angle characteristics.
